In this volume the relationship between grey wolf Legoshi and dwarf rabbit Haru grows stronger, but not without consequences. Grey wolf Juno’s jealousy begins to boil, adding tension to an already fragile dynamic. Red deer Louis’s sudden and mysterious absence from Cherryton Academy creates ripples across both friends and rivals, leaving questions that will shape the future. Beyond the school walls, the lion gang Shishi-gumi appoints a new leader while the headmaster of Cherryton Academy joins the Council of Living Beings to select the next Beastar, a choice that could reshape society. Readers are also treated to a powerful flashback into Legoshi and Jack’s puppyhoods, alongside insight into the post war social engineering that maintains the uneasy truce between carnivores and herbivores.
